Creating a Fun Valance
by Nikki Willhite
Description: Instructions for making an easy valance for your windows.
Here is one of the more inexpensive, fun ways to make a custom
valance for the window over your kitchen sink, in a children's
room, or even on top of a shower curtain.
All you need is a wooden dowel or any strip of wood that you can
attach across the top of your window or shower, and some napkins.
Pick out some napkins that match the decor in your room. You can
make them yourself (vintage fabrics are always cute), or you can
buy them at the store.
Fold the napkins in half, diagonally, and drape them over the
wood, so that they hang down like triangles. Use as many napkins
as you need to cover the width of the wooden rod.
To add more interest, layer 2 rows of napkins. Make the back row
longer, perhaps in a solid color. Then add a shorter napkin,
perhaps a floral or check, in the front. You can even add
tassels, bells, or other ornaments on the points of the front
valance to rest on the back fabric.
Secure the napkins by stapling the long end on the top of the
rod. Before you begin, lay the rod out on your table and play
with the napkins until you find an arrangement you like. Mark the
rod, and then staple them down.
This is a fun treatment for a window, and looks best when done in
playful and colorful fabrics.
